2017-08-07 135 views
1

我正在構建基於瀏覽器的應用程序進行文檔掃描。我曾經看過來自dynamosoft,asprise,atalasoft等多家供應商的產品。在基於瀏覽器的文檔掃描方面,我的基本問題是這些產品是否能夠使用基於瀏覽器的界面從遠程計算機掃描?或者應該將掃描儀始終連接到啓動瀏覽器的系統?基於瀏覽器的文檔掃描

回答

2

是。基於瀏覽器的文檔掃描依賴於本地服務和Web客戶端之間的通信。通常,您需要在第一次瀏覽文檔掃描的在線演示時下載本地服務的安裝程序。如果您想掃描遠程機器上的文件,只需在該機器上部署該服務即可。然後更改Web套接字連接的IP。

例如,這裏是Dynamic Web TWAIN的架構。

enter image description here

掃描儀應當從本地服務(而非網絡瀏覽器)啓動始終連接到系統上。

您可以通過觀看video瞭解如何使用作爲掃描儀服務的Raspberry Pi從iMac捕獲文檔。

1

是的,有一個應用程序可以在遠程機器上啓用掃描。當有人打開瀏覽器時,Web瀏覽器和本地計算機應用程序之間建立連接。這個連接很容易通過HTML5 Web Socket完成。本地應用程序會掃描並通過此連接將此圖像發送到您的瀏覽器。 這裏是開放源碼庫,

ScanAppForWeb

+0

看到這種設計非常有趣。 ScanAppForWeb中基於表單的應用程序的作用是什麼?瀏覽器如何連接到它?你在那裏使用HTML5網絡套接字嗎? – user3172614

+0

是HTML5 Web套接字。這是Windows窗體應用程序負責的,它在本地機器上打開Web套接字服務器。掃描完成後發送給瀏覽器。 –